Grassroots Radio Conference 2024

What is a Grassroots Radio Conference? (GRC)

There are about 200 community radio stations around the U.S. and many more around the world.  Once a year they come together to share information to make their stations better and improve radio shows. In 2024, New Orleans was chosen to be the conference city

There were 4 days of sessions including workshops, guest speakers, and panel discussions.  Over 150 community radio people came to come to the conference that was held on September 26-29 Sponsored by WHIV FM, New Orleans and held at historic Gallier Hall.

In 2011, Kansas City was the conference city sponsored by KKFI FM and Friends of Community Media.

The annual Grassroots Radio Conference is a must-attend event for the community media sector. It brings together diverse radio professionals, activists, and community members to discuss the challenges and opportunities facing independent and community-based radio stations. By participating in this conference, the attendees gained valuable insights, networked with like-minded individuals, and contributed to community media development.
